Transaction 58dc3cef3243d4a62b2fe19d33c75563ef3e458c126dc46a9c1fea34bcfaa9ba

1 Input
2 Outputs
  • 58dc3cef3243d4a62b2fe19d33c75563ef3e458c126dc46a9c1fea34bcfaa9ba:0
  • value  1379831
    address  3Bh2yzqrkUN7njTFKE6Y3qZpghx8QxWHNX
  • 58dc3cef3243d4a62b2fe19d33c75563ef3e458c126dc46a9c1fea34bcfaa9ba:1
  • value  80056
    address  1BkXf67jRoxTLmdvVwbgBqcoAECJHPNkpr